Market Overview
 Ultrawideband (UWB) is a wireless communication technology that uses very high-frequency radio waves to transmit data. UWB operates across a broad frequency spectrum, allowing for faster data rates, greater accuracy in location tracking, and interference-free communication in crowded environments. With its ability to penetrate walls and obstacles, UWB is being adopted for a wide range of applications, from wireless personal area networks (WPANs) to advanced tracking and real-time location systems (RTLS).
Key Drivers of Market Growth
- Increased Smartphone Adoption: The growing number of smartphone users globally is a key factor driving UWB adoption. The technology is already integrated into smartphones such as the Apple iPhone and Samsung Galaxy, enabling features like digital keys and proximity-based services.
 - Rising Demand for High-Speed Connectivity: With applications in virtual reality (VR), augmented reality (AR), and high-speed LAN/WAN systems, the need for faster data transfer rates and low-latency communication is accelerating the growth of UWB technology.
 - Growth of the Industrial Internet of Things (IoT): The integration of UWB in IoT applications, which enables high-precision location sensing and process automation, is fueling its adoption in industries such as manufacturing, logistics, and healthcare.
 - Smart Home and Automotive Applications: The adoption of UWB technology in smart home systems and the automotive industry, such as smart locks, contactless car access, and advanced driver-assistance systems (ADAS), is expected to drive further market expansion.
 
Technological Advancements
Leading manufacturers are investing heavily in R&D to enhance UWB technology’s capabilities. Innovations such as multi-band UWB chips, longer-range UWB systems, and improved power efficiency are transforming the competitive landscape. For example, in 2022, Apple’s U1 chip, integrated into its devices, revolutionized proximity-based services and geolocation features. Furthermore, the ongoing development of UWB for advanced security applications, such as real-time locating systems (RTLS) and vehicle tracking, is expected to boost market growth.
Challenges
Despite its potential, the Ultrawideband market faces challenges, including regulatory limitations, privacy concerns, and the high cost of UWB systems. Moreover, the need for standardized UWB protocols and infrastructure to support widespread adoption remains a key hurdle.

Regional Analysis
North America dominates the UWB market, driven by the increasing adoption of smart home devices and automotive applications. The presence of key market players such as Apple, Texas Instruments, and Zebra Technologies further contributes to this region's market dominance. Moreover, the increasing use of UWB for automotive and IoT applications is expected to drive continued growth.
Asia-Pacific is expected to witness steady growth in the UWB market, owing to the rising penetration of smartphones and the need for high-speed data transfer across industries. The region is also seeing significant R&D investments aimed at enhancing UWB capabilities for various applications, including industrial IoT and automotive systems.
